Critical catalog of the lending library she composed between 1915 and 1932. I. French literature and general culture, philosophy, religions, history, travel, political economy, fine arts, sciences. Paris, La Maison des Amis des livres, [1932].
In-8 [238 x 187] of XV, 247 pp. 1 plate: paperback, in a modern grey morocco spine case.
First edition.
First part, the only one published, of the critical catalog of the lending library created by Adrienne Monnier in 1915. It is illustrated with an out-of-text photomontage by Janet
Le Caisne, a portrait of Adrienne Monnier in front of the shelves of her bookshop.
One of 20 numbered copies on Lafuma paper (n° 13), offered by the author to the historian Charles de La Morandière (1887-1971), with an autograph signed letter on the false title: à Charles de La Morandière // en amical hommage // Adrienne Monnier // Octobre 1932
The copy is accompanied by the autograph manuscript of the preface that Adrienne Monnier wrote in 1918 and that she had printed at the head of the catalog.
This manuscript, written in blue ink in a lined notebook on 21 pages, presents some differences with the printed version and unpublished passages.
